Output 3d0c17528f998f59f1d56918233c6675a9158212f3c9895de145879b65411f81:1

value
1222225
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3e938a0baf8981464d87dada82c74145a2e68a4a OP_EQUAL
address
37PtZeGg5hNEbMApE9bhTTXnyUQJWgHCHu
transaction
3d0c17528f998f59f1d56918233c6675a9158212f3c9895de145879b65411f81
spent
true